When selecting a display for professional or consumer use, one of the most critical decisions is choosing between 2K and 4K resolution options. These resolutions significantly impact image clarity, screen real estate, and overall user experience—especially in fields like graphic design, video editing, gaming, and data visualization.
2K resolution, often referred to as QHD (2560x1440), offers a sharp and immersive visual experience on monitors ranging from 24 to 32 inches. It provides nearly double the pixel count of Full HD (1080p), making text crisper, images more detailed, and UI elements easier to navigate. For professionals working with digital media, 2K strikes an excellent balance between performance and cost. Many modern GPUs can drive 2K at high refresh rates without straining system resources—a key factor for competitive gaming or multitasking workflows. On the other hand, 4K resolution (3840x2160) delivers ultra-high-definition visuals ideal for content creators, filmmakers, and users who demand maximum detail. With four times the pixels of Full HD, 4K allows for larger virtual workspaces, enabling multiple applications to run side by side without compromise. Both 2K and 4K are supported across major monitor brands such as Dell, LG, ASUS, and BenQ, with options including IPS panels for wide viewing angles and HDR support for enhanced contrast. When choosing between them, consider your primary use case: if you prioritize performance and value, 2K may be sufficient; for ultimate detail and future-proofing, 4K is worth the investment. Always ensure your computer’s GPU, cable (DisplayPort 1.4 or HDMI 2.0+), and software settings align with your chosen resolution for optimal results.
